Does Postgres run on Ubuntu?

PostgreSQL is available in all Ubuntu versions by default, but it doesn’t guarantee automatic updates when new releases come out. The local repository only has “snapshots” of a specific version. The best practice is to install the software from the PostgreSQL Apt Repository.

How do I know which port Postgres is running?

First, find the “postmaster” process, the parent of all other PostgreSQL processes. You can get it from the postmaster. pid file in the PostgreSQL data directory if the database is started. That will show you the port where PostgreSQL is listening.

Connecting to PostgreSQL

  1. Log into the postgres user: su – postgres.
  2. This will bring you to a new prompt. Log into the database by typing: psql.
  3. You should now see a prompt for postgres=#. This means you are at a PostgreSQL prompt. To exit the interface, you can type: q. From there, you can get back to root by typing: exit.

Kedu otu m ga -esi elele ma ọ bụrụ na ọdụ ụgbọ mmiri 5432 emepere?

You have to check the listening address. As you can see it is only listening on that port via the localhost IP ( 127.0. 0.1:5432 ). The port is not open for external connections, which is the default setup and the most secure for most cases.
